## volume
|
||||
|
||||
- `0Axy`: **Volume slide.**
|
||||
- If `x` is 0 then this is a slide down.
|
||||
- If `y` is 0 then this is a slide up.
|
||||
- `F8xx`: **Single tick volume slide up.**
|
||||
- `F9xx`: **Single tick volume slide down.**
|
||||
- `F3xx`: **Fine volume slide up.** 64× slower than `0Axy`.
|
||||
- `F4xx`: **Fine volume slide down.** 64× slower than `0Axy`.
|
||||
- `FAxy`: **Fast volume slide.** 4× faster than `0Axy`.
|
||||
- If `x` is 0 then this is a slide down.
|
||||
- If `y` is 0 then this is a slide up.
|
||||
- If `x` is 0 then this slides volume down by `y` each tick.
|
||||
- If `y` is 0 then this slides volume up by `x` each tick.
|
||||
- `FAxy`: **Fast volume slide.** same as `0Axy` above but 4× faster.
|
||||
- `F3xx`: **Fine volume slide up.** same as `0Ax0` but 64× slower.
|
||||
- `F4xx`: **Fine volume slide down.** same as `0A0x` but 64× slower.
|
||||
- `F8xx`: **Single tick volume slide up.** adds `x` to volume on first tick only.
|
||||
- `F9xx`: **Single tick volume slide down.** subtracts `x` from volume on first tick only.<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`07xy`: **Tremolo.** changes volume to be "wavy" with a sine LFO. `x` is the speed, while `y` is the depth.
|
||||
- `07xy`: **Tremolo.** changes volume to be "wavy" with a sine LFO. `x` is the speed. `y` is the depth.
|
||||
- Tremolo is downward only.
|
||||
- Maximum tremolo depth is -60 volume steps.

- `01xx`: **Pitch slide up.**
|
||||
- `02xx`: **Pitch slide down.**
|
||||
- `F1xx`: **Single tick pitch slide up.**
|
||||
- `F2xx`: **Single tick pitch slide down.**
|
||||
- `F2xx`: **Single tick pitch slide down.**<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`03xx`: **Portamento.** slides the current note's pitch to the specified note.
|
||||
- `03xx`: **Portamento.** slides the current note's pitch to the specified note. `x` is the slide speed.
|
||||
- A note _must_ be present for this effect to work.
|
||||
- `E1xy`: **Note slide up.** `x` is the speed, while `y` is how many semitones to slide up.
|
||||
- `E2xy`: **Note slide down.** `x` is the speed, while `y` is how many semitones to slide down.
|
||||
- `E2xy`: **Note slide down.** `x` is the speed, while `y` is how many semitones to slide down.<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`EAxx`: **Toggle legato.** while on, notes instantly change the pitch of the currrently playing sound instead of starting it over.
|
||||
- `00xy`: **Arpeggio.** after using this effect the channel will rapidly switch between semitone values of `note`, `note + x` and `note + y`.
|
||||
- `E0xx`: **Set arpeggio speed.** this sets the number of ticks between arpeggio values.
|
||||
- `E0xx`: **Set arpeggio speed.** this sets the number of ticks between arpeggio values. default is 1.<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`04xy`: **Vibrato.** changes pitch to be "wavy" with a sine LFO. `x` is the speed, while `y` is the depth.
|
||||
- Maximum vibrato depth is ±1 semitone.
|
||||
- `E3xx`: **Set vibrato direction.** `xx` may be one of the following:
|
||||
- `00`: Up and down.
|
||||
- `00`: Up and down. default.
|
||||
- `01`: Up only.
|
||||
- `02`: Down only.
|
||||
- `E4xx`: **Set vibrato range** in 1/16th of a semitone.

- `08xy`: **Set panning.** changes stereo volumes independently. `x` is the left channel and `y` is the right one.
|
||||
- `88xy`: **Set rear panning.** changes rear channel volumes independently. `x` is the rear left channel and `y` is the rear right one.
|
||||
- `81xx`: **Set volume of left chann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
- `82xx`: **Set volume of right chann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
- `89xx`: **Set volume of rear left chann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
- `8Axx`: **Set volume of rear right channel** (from `00` to `FF`).<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`80xx`: **Set panning (linear).** this effect behaves more like other trackers:
|
||||
- `00` is left.
|
||||
- `80` is center.
|
||||
- `FF` is right.
|
||||
- `81xx`: **Set volume of left chann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
- `82xx`: **Set volume of right chann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
- `89xx`: **Set volume of rear left chann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
- `8Axx`: **Set volume of rear right channel** (from `00` to `FF`).
|
||||
|
||||
## time
|
||||
|
||||
- `09xx`: **Set speed/groove.** if no grooves are defined, this sets speed. If alternating speeds are active, this sets the first speed.
|
||||
- `0Fxx`: **Set speed 2.** during alternating speeds or a groove, this sets the second speed.
|
||||
- `0Fxx`: **Set speed 2.** during alternating speeds or a groove, this sets the second speed.<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`Cxxx`: **Set tick rate.** changes tick rate to `xxx` Hz (ticks per second).
|
||||
- `xxx` may be from `000` to `3ff`.
|
||||
- `F0xx`: **Set BPM.** changes tick rate according to beats per minute.
|
||||
- `xxx` may be from `000` to `3FF`.
|
||||
- `F0xx`: **Set BPM.** changes tick rate according to beats per minute. range is `01` to `FF`.<hr>
|
||||
|
||||
- `0Bxx`: **Jump to order.** this can be used to loop a song.
|
||||
- `0Dxx`: **Jump to next pattern.** this can be used to shorten the current order.
|
||||
- `FFxx`: **Stop song.** stops playback and ends the song.
|
||||
- `0Bxx`: **Jump to order.** `x` is the order to play after the current row.
|
||||
- this marks the end of a loop with order `x` as the loop start.
|
||||
- `0Dxx`: **Jump to next pattern.** skips the current row and remainder of current order.
|
||||
- this can be used to shorten the current order.
|
||||
- `FFxx`: **Stop song.** stops playback and ends the song. `x` is ignored.
